“Nothing Gold Can Stay.” It is the name of a poem by Robert Frost; it is also the message he conveys in several of his works. While reflecting on this piece as well as “A Patch of Old Snow” we can come to a greater understanding as to why “Nothing Gold Can Stay.”

As nature’s first green starts to show itself, it is such a sight. The people, the ground, and the sky are a miserable grey from months of a dreary winter. Then as if out of nowhere a flower pops out of the ground, a bright green bud.
